The Outlaw
Art
Oval base with rough textured surface to base and realistic, 3D cast of bucking horse/outlaw balanced on front legs with rear legs in air. Cowboy wearing leather chaps balances on horse in saddle. There is a reign in one hand, cowboy hangs onto the saddle with the other hand. Work has strong silhouette, original brown patina and continual contrast of matte and shiny surfaces. Cast #15
